A Stress ECG: Examining Cardiac Performance Under Pressure
A cardiac stress ECG, also known as a exercise test , provides critical information about heart health when it’s working greater workload. Unlike a regular ECG, which shows heart activity at rest , a stress test records the heart responds to physical exertion . This helps physicians to uncover potential blockages that are not visible during a resting ECG. Usually , the test involves running on a device or using a stationary bike while sensors on your chest measure electrical signals . Findings from a stress ECG can assist in guiding the best course of action.
- Can reveal narrowing in the arteries
- Assists in evaluating the extent of heart problems
- Offers information about oxygen supply to the heart

ECG Types Explained: From Baseline to Continuous Monitoring
An electrocardiogram provides a recorded representation of the myocardial electrical activity . Standard ECGs are typically taken during a quiet state and offer a snapshot of usual rhythm . In contrast , click here continuous ECG monitoring tracks the heart's pulse signals over a duration of time, useful for detecting intermittent arrhythmias or other heart events. These extended recordings are essential in acute settings and can aid in the diagnosis of various heart conditions . Subsequent variations, like exercise ECGs, provide information about cardiac response under physical load.
